I have played that demo and find it hard to believe anyone could get more than one hit, let alone two meaningful hits. As Mobius has posted, once a hit is secured, then it has to be a turret hit, and then it only has a small chance to do damage.
I am actually fine with the small damage percentage (4%) since turret roof armor includes a fan that naturally would have some direct opening to the interior, the hatches may have had VERY thin armor or edge areas, and possibly a chance of getting a hit right behind the gun shield. I still say fragmentation from a typical cast iron mortar bomb would have little to no chance of making penetrations on armor.
